Empowering the local residents to develop communal vegitable plots is leading to greener, more sustainable communities in inner city London.

Bankside Open Spaces Trusts runs the Diversity Garden programme which encourages families, local schools and residential groups from social housing estates near Waterloo to grow their own vegitables in communal gardens.

The Trust works with these communities by offering advice, support and training.
